Top 5 Entertainment Mascot Games in the Middle East Q2 2022
In Q2 2022, the Middle East saw notable performance from top entertainment mascot games, with trends in weekly downloads, revenue, and active users varying across titles.
The second quarter of 2022 showcased interesting trends for the top five entertainment mascot games in the Middle East on a unified platform. Here's a look at how each game performed in terms of weekly downloads, revenue, and active users.
Sonic Dash: Fun Endless Runner from SEGA experienced a steady increase in weekly revenue, peaking at approximately $1.8K in the week of June 6. Weekly downloads showed a mid-quarter dip, reaching 23.6K in the last week of May, before stabilizing around 29.7K by the end of June. The game maintained a consistent active user base, fluctuating around 428K weekly active users throughout the quarter.
Sonic Forces PvP Racing Battle also from SEGA, saw a notable spike in weekly revenue, peaking at around $3.9K in early May. Weekly downloads reached their highest at 48.7K in the same period. Active users showed a rise to approximately 121K in the first week of May, followed by a gradual decline to around 71.6K by the end of June.
Crash Bandicoot: On the Run! from King experienced relatively stable weekly revenue, with a high of approximately $1.5K in late April. Weekly downloads peaked at about 18.3K in early May. The game maintained a strong active user base, peaking at roughly 179K in mid-April before stabilizing around 153K by the end of June.
Sonic Dash 2: Sonic Boom, another SEGA title, saw modest weekly revenue figures, peaking at around $564 in late April. Weekly downloads reached their highest at 15.8K in mid-April. Active users showed a peak of approximately 62.7K in the same period, with a gradual decline to about 33.3K by the end of June.
Finally, Minion Rush: Running game from Gameloft, generated a consistent weekly revenue around $506 in early May. Weekly downloads saw a peak of approximately 15.3K in late April, with active users peaking at around 34.3K in the same timeframe before stabilizing around 33.3K by the end of June.
